Surrounding Verses: 2 Chronicles 17

1

And Jehoshaphat his son reigned in his stead, and strengthened himself against Israel.

2

And he placed forces in all the fenced cities of Judah, and set garrisons in the land of Judah, and in the cities of Ephraim, which Asa his father had taken.

3

And the Lord was with Jehoshaphat, because he walked in the first ways of his father David, and sought not unto Baalim;

4

But sought to the Lord God of his father, and walked in his commandments, and not after the doings of Israel.

5

Therefore the Lord stablished the kingdom in his hand; and all Judah brought to Jehoshaphat presents; and he had riches and honour in abundance.
